    Vivitar Series 1 200mm ƒ/3, mid-1970s. The company was founded in 1938 as Ponder and Best by Max Ponder and John Best. Max Ponder headed the sales department, while John Best ran the operations side of the company. Ponder and Best first imported German-made photo equipment.

    3D standard HD camcorder. A 3D standard camcorder is similar in size to a conventional camcorder with an enlarged lens. The larger lenses provide better images than a 3D pocket camcorder. The first Consumer 3D camcorder was the Toshiba SK-3D7K, exhibited at CES 1988 in Las Vegas and available for purchase in 1989.

    A network video recorder ( NVR) is a specialized computer system that records video [ 1] to a disk drive, USB flash drive, memory card, or other mass storage device. An NVR itself contains no cameras, but connects to them through a network, typically as part of an IP video surveillance system. NVRs typically have embedded operating systems .
